We have received an email from Jane Davies from Swimming Officials Administration regarding the teacher/coach licensing scheme. In order to get licensing, coaches need to get a form signed at each Gala/Meet they attend, which will give them points for licensing purposes, this is because each coach needs to prove that they have coached swimmers to a certain level, this form needs to be signed by the Referee of the Gala.

Coach’s Report

This years Bridon Shield took place at Adwick Pool on Sunday the 29th of April, with Sharks entering teams for all age groups except the boys open team. We won 3 first place positions (the 13yr old girls in the medley relay – Anna Laird, Amy Watson, Emily Fordham and Alice Lambert, the 13yr old boys in the freestyle relay – Charlie Cocks, Richard Eke, Harvey Thornton and Daniel Leggott and the 10yr old girls in the freestyle relay – Lily Webb, Lucy Windle, Hayley Lewis and Phillipa Smith). In addition Sharks won eight second place positions and the final results were as follows: Armthorpe 163 points, Adwick 124, Askern Spa 107, Sharks 106, Edlington 42, Thorne Tigers 32 and Rossington 18 points. Thank you all Sharks swimmers who took part, it was a fantastic effort.

On the 12th of May, Sharks took part in the second round of the Lincs Senior League, where we finished fourth, the final results as follows: Lincoln Vulcans A 257 points, South Lincs 194, Louth 176, Sharks 137, Trenton Dolphins 121 and Grimsby Santamarina 112 points.

The same day saw the Masters Team at Scarborough again, with the traditional cake and coffee to start before warm-up. This time we saw new Masters swimmers putting in an appearance in the form of Nick Buxton and Jackie Buxton, who were amongst our usual veteran Scarborough Masters swimmers, with everyone giving their best performances it was a good Gala. The teams did very well with wins in 2 relay events, 2 second placings and 2 third positions.

Sharks took part in the second round of the Lincs Junior League on the 19th of May at Gainsborough. The swimmers put in some great performances especially as we were a few swimmers short and therefore Kev had to swim some of the swimmers up to cover the older age group teams. We finished in third place, which was a fantastic result. The results were as follows: Lincoln Vulcans A 273 points, South Lincs 206, Sharks 186, Grantham 149, Trenton Dolphins 146 and Lincoln Pentaqua B 77 points.
